Refrigerator FAQs


What is the ideal temperature for my refrigerator?
The optimal temperature range for a refrigerator is between 35-39° F. For more information about why this temperature range is best and tips on keeping a consistent temperature, click here.

My refrigerator is producing condensation. What can I do to fix it?
If your refrigerator is producing condensation – either on the inside or outside – it is a sure-fire sign that something is wrong. The most common reasons for condensation are a faulty door gasket, dirty condenser coils, and a clogged drain tube. Click here for more information regarding this.


How do I clean my refrigerator condenser coils?
Cleaning your refrigerator's condenser coils is a great way to increase energy efficiency and prevent future breakdowns. On most models, these coils are located on the back of the unit and can be cleaned with a vacuum. For more detailed instructions, click here.


I think my drain tube is backed up. How do I unclog it?
If you have an automatic-defrosting refrigerator, the drain tube can get clogged and cause water to pool near the bottom of the interior. For step-by-step instructions on unclogging it, click here.


What are the different types of refrigerator styles?
There are four main types of refrigerator styles – top-freezer, bottom-freezer, French door, and side-by-side. Each of these styles offer their own unique benefits. For a comprehensive breakdown of the different refrigerator styles, click here.
